While the acid house hoopla spawned in the UK and Europe, in Chicago it achieved its peak about 1988 after which you can declined in acceptance.[citation needed] Alternatively, a crossover of house and hip-hop music, referred to as hip house, turned well-liked. Tyree Cooper's one "Flip Up the Bass" showcasing Kool Rock Regular from 1988 was an influential breakthrough for this subgenre, Even though the British trio the Beatmasters claimed having invented the style with their 1986 launch "Rok da House".
